Solution for 3x+5y-3=18 equation:


Simplifying
3x + 5y + -3 = 18

Reorder the terms:
-3 + 3x + 5y = 18

Solving
-3 + 3x + 5y = 18

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'3' to each side of the equation.
-3 + 3x + 3 + 5y = 18 + 3

Reorder the terms:
-3 + 3 + 3x + 5y = 18 + 3

Combine like terms: -3 + 3 = 0
0 + 3x + 5y = 18 + 3
3x + 5y = 18 + 3

Combine like terms: 18 + 3 = 21
3x + 5y = 21

Add '-5y' to each side of the equation.
3x + 5y + -5y = 21 + -5y

Combine like terms: 5y + -5y = 0
3x + 0 = 21 + -5y
3x = 21 + -5y

Divide each side by '3'.
x = 7 + -1.666666667y

Simplifying
x = 7 + -1.666666667y
